Seattle, Washington, USA – October 16, 2024:

In a bold move that could redefine the energy landscape, Amazon has joined the ranks of tech giants investing in nuclear power. The company's $500 million investment in X-energy, a developer of advanced modular nuclear reactors (AMRs), marks a significant shift towards cleaner, more sustainable energy sources.

The decision comes at a critical time, as the global demand for energy, particularly for powering data centers and artificial intelligence applications, continues to soar. Traditional energy sources, such as fossil fuels, have come under increasing scrutiny due to their environmental impact. Nuclear power, with its potential for large-scale, carbon-free energy generation, has emerged as a promising alternative.

Amazon's investment in X-energy is not just about meeting its own energy needs. It's a strategic bet on the future of clean energy. By supporting the development of AMRs, the company is helping to pave the way for a new generation of nuclear technology that is safer, more efficient, and less costly to build and operate.

AMRs, unlike traditional nuclear reactors, are smaller and modular, making them easier to deploy and less susceptible to catastrophic failures. They also have a lower upfront cost and a shorter construction timeline, which could accelerate their adoption.

Amazon's investment in X-energy is part of a broader trend among tech companies to seek out cleaner energy sources. Microsoft, for example, has been exploring the possibility of reopening the Three Mile Island nuclear plant, while Google has partnered with Kairos Power to develop advanced nuclear reactors.

The growing interest in nuclear power among tech giants is driven by a number of factors. First, these companies have a strong commitment to sustainability and a desire to reduce their carbon footprint. Second, they recognize that reliable, affordable energy is essential for their operations, and nuclear power can provide a stable and predictable supply.

However, the path to widespread adoption of nuclear power is not without its challenges. Public concerns about safety and waste disposal remain significant hurdles. Additionally, the regulatory environment for nuclear projects can be complex and time-consuming.

Amazon's investment in X-energy is a major step forward in addressing these challenges. By supporting the development of AMRs, the company is helping to demonstrate the viability of this technology and build public confidence in its safety.
